Randy Couture will Knock James Toney's "Lights Out"
NABO and IBA heavyweight boxing champion James “Lights Out” Toney is near finalizing a contract to fight UFC Hall of Famer Randy Couture in the Octagon at UFC 118 in Boston’s TD Garden on Aug. 28.
At this juncture, the only minor obstacle preventing the contest is the weight at which the fight will be contested. Nevertheless, both sides agree that the matchup will ultimately be cemented at either 215 or 220 pounds.
Toney (72-6-3-2, 44 KOs), named Ring Magazine's Fighter of the Year in both 1991 and 2003, was a very skilled prizefighter who won titles in multiple weight classes.
However, Toney is also a portly specimen, in the mold of the character “Precious,” who was twice pinched for using the steroids boldenone and stanozolol.
“Toney couldn’t have beaten Couture in his prime and he thinks he can even compete with him now in the condition he’s in,” questioned Brad Sherwood, a trainer at Gold’s Gym in Medford, Ore.
For whatever reason, UFC President Dana White has expressed confidence that Toney can flourish in the world of mixed martial arts. Toney is being trained by famed MMA instructor Juanito Ibarra.
“We have been working on stretching, sprawling, and movement, all the things he will need to get a handle on,” said Ibarra, who once trained Quinton “Rampage” Jackson.
Even at 46, Couture (18-10), the only five-time titlist in UFC history, will absolutely lambaste Toney with his ground-and-pound attack.
“He’s been running his mouth saying he’s going to knock everybody out,” said Couture, a three-time National Collegiate Athletic Association (NCAA) Division-I All-America wrestler. “I’d be happy to welcome him to MMA.”
